 DATA SHEET
NPN SILICON RF TRANSISTOR
2SC5801
NPN SILICON RF TRANSISTOR FOR HIGH-FREQUENCY LOW NOISE 3-PIN LEAD-LESS MINIMOLD
FEATURES
* Low phase distortion, low voltage operation * Ideal for OSC applications * 3-pin lead-less minimold package

ABSOLUTE MAXIMUM RATINGS (TA = +25C)
Parameter Collector to Base Voltage Collector to Emitter Voltage Emitter to Base Voltage Collector Current Total Power Dissipation Junction Temperature Storage Temperature Symbol VCBO VCEO VEBO IC Ptot
Note
Ratings 9.0 5.5 1.5 100 140 150 -65 to +150
Unit V V V mA mW C C
Tj Tstg
2 Note Mounted on 1.08 cm x 1.0 mm (t) glass epoxy PCB
